Two music superstars have been lighting up Paris this week: Beyoncé with her massive Cowboy Carter tour, and Miley Cyrus promoting her latest album, Something Beautiful—both turning heads with a series of vintage-inspired street style looks. Last night, they took things to the next level, teaming up for a surprise performance that left the city buzzing—complete with matching gold outfits.

During her June 19 show at the Stade de France, Beyoncé brought Miley onstage, saying, “I love y’all so much. I’m super excited because I wanted to do something very special for you. Give it up—I’m so grateful to sing with you, Ms. Miley Cyrus!” The duo then performed “II Most Wanted” from Cowboy Carter, their Grammy-winning country collaboration, sending the crowd into a frenzy.

Both artists dazzled in head-to-toe gold sequins—Beyoncé in a fringed bodysuit with a jeweled neckline and cowboy boots, while Miley rocked a shimmering crystal catsuit with stiletto boots. Their shared fashion motto? Go big, go bold, go gold.

Beyoncé’s tour has been a showcase of high-fashion Western glam, with looks styled by Shiona Turini, Ty Hunter, and Karen Langley. She’s worn everything from a white Mugler bodysuit with diamond-studded chaps to Burberry’s sequined plaid and a denim-printed Roberto Cavalli catsuit. Even her daughter, Blue Ivy, has joined the spectacle in custom rodeo-inspired outfits, including a gold gown and a green Burberry bodysuit to match her mom.

Though their style choices differ—Beyoncé favoring Mugler and Ferragamo, Miley leaning into Alaïa and Versace—both share a love for over-the-top glamour, often meeting in the middle with Schiaparelli and Cavalli.

With the Cowboy Carter tour now past its halfway point, Beyoncé heads back to the U.S. for stops in Houston, D.C., Atlanta, and Las Vegas, wrapping up on July 26.
